Caballito is, almost literally, the geographic centre of the city, solid, residential, middle-class in the best sense, with Parque Rivadavia, good transport and none of the pretension.
It is a local barrio, which means demand is driven by Argentines upgrading, not by tourism, and that is a healthy, durable kind of demand. For a yield-focused buyer who wants a building that stays rented to good long-term tenants, Caballito is dependable. Not flashy. Dependable.
What it costs
As of late 2025, published asking prices in Caballito sit around USD 2,250 / m² for an apartment (Zonaprop index). Keep one thing in mind: those are asking prices, not closings. What actually changes hands is usually a notch below the sticker, and negotiating that gap into your pocket is precisely what you hire a broker for.
